Description

P25cm tall pincushion cactus with red spines and flowers. A small artificial cacti potted in a stone geometric style pot and surrounded by faux gravel. Suitable for indoor decoration, the cactus is handcrafted from a sturdy polyfoam which has been UV treated to ensure lasting colour. Ideal for office desk or coffee table decoration, it will introduce an on-trend desert style into your home or workplace. Part of Homescapes collection of artificial cacti and succulents, Homescapes are on of the UKs leading manufacturer and retailer of artificial plants and trees with a huge range of exclusive designs. To care for your cactus it is recommended that it is kept out of direct sunlight and is wiped clean regularly. p

Humble Beginnings

In 1980, Chris Dawson set up a simple open-air market stall in Plymouth. By 1989, this entrepreneurial spirit led to the opening of the very first physical store on Billacombe Road, originally named "C.D.S. Superstores". However, in the early '90s, a rebranding took place, introducing "The Range" to the world.

Today, with a whopping 200+ stores across the UK, The Range boasts an impressive selection of over 65,000 products, spreading across 16 diverse departments, all dedicated to enhancing homes and lifestyles.

A Visionary Leader

Chris Dawson, the brain behind The Range, held the CEO position from 1989 to 2017. With a flair for business, Chris's achievements haven't gone unnoticed. He was even ranked fifth in a survey of Britain's Top 100 Entrepreneurs.

Under his leadership, The Range has not only thrived locally but has also hinted at European expansion dreams, envisioning a staggering 1,000 stores across the continent.

More Than Just Stores

You can find The Range in many places, mostly outside town centres, but also in shopping areas. Some stores have a coffee shop called "Dee Dee's", and others even have a food section from Iceland. And if you like online shopping, The Range has got you covered there too with a big online store.
